Resumo: This work proposes a methodology to compare the performance of different architec- tures’ CPUs on HPC applications while considering architectural differences that could not be exploited without an appropriately configured environment. This goal is achieved by using the testing tool provided by Chameleon, which implements parallel dense linear algebra routines, supported by the runtime system StarPU, which implements task-based parallelism to support executions on heterogeneous architectures. The proposed method- ology is then put to the test to analyse the Intel hybrid CPUs introduced by their Alder Lake microarchitecture.
